Finding GCD of 796, 209, 288, 648 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 796, 209, 288, 648

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 796 is 2 x 2 x 199

Prime Factorization of 209 is 11 x 19

Prime Factorization of 288 is 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 3 x 3

Prime Factorization of 648 is 2 x 2 x 2 x 3 x 3 x 3 x 3

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
